American physical therapy association
Instilling professionalism and quality services in the healthcare industry is prime focus of the American Physical Therapy Association (APTA). This health-centered organization somehow serves as the spokesperson of thousands of medical facilities from different American states in the northern and southern parts. To date, there are more than 72,000 members adhering to the goals and future visions of American Physical Therapy Association. Since year 2000, American Physical Therapy Association has been gearing towards excellence by 2020 in all aspects of physical therapy practice-may it be academic quest, technology upgrades and actual therapeutic applications. To instill a healthier America, the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) has come into terms of partnership with American Physical Therapy Association to furnish the member individuals and groups of APTA some significant information, counseling and accessibility to beneficial training materials designed to give the workers security and wellbeing. Both associations' thrust is to lessen and avoid exposure to hazard influences that may worsen musculoskeletal troubles and responding to ergonomic cases. OSHA and American Physical Therapy Association will join forces in offering educational and training programs on physical therapy care, recognition, prevention and rehabilitation. Information drive campaigns about effective approaches, latest milestones and new products to cure and heal a physically impaired individual will be materialized. Conferences, meetings and seminars will also be held to increase knowledge among physical and occupational therapists. The American Physical Therapy Association has also released an informative wellness guide that inscribes information about physiology, injury, therapy routines and human anatomy. Basic tips in fixing bodily malfunctions, sores, injuries, muscle impairment, work strains, neck stiffness and other ailments are also available in this literature. Even the easy approach of flexibility and stretching exercises are in it to address simple issues. With passion and dedication the American Physical Therapy Association will realize its so-called 2020 goal of greater excellence will further alleviate the roles of physical therapy profession's medical approaches while protecting the rights of its members. For APTA, the medical practice of physical therapy will be far beyond excellence when all physical therapists that have Doctorate degrees and acknowledged as health care professionals shall have immediate access for the assessment, diagnosis, intervention and prevention areas. By 2020, American Physical Therapy Association envisions America to be one that's served by doctors of physical therapy who are board-certified. All Americans will have convenient access to physical therapists in all environment conditions.
